Don’t put on too much weight when you are pregnant. Gaining too much can pose a health problems and make it hard to lose later. Average women should expect to gain somewhere between 15 and thirty pounds during the entire course of pregnancy.

If you are pregnant, you need to make sure to exercise on a regular basis. This can reduce your chances of a miscarriage, how long you’re in labor, along with helping you lose the weight easier after birth.

Wear sunscreen if you are pregnant, even if you didn’t really require it before.You should also stay away from tanning bed.Your skin is quite sensitive during pregnancy, making you more susceptible to sunburn.

Pregnant women need to be as much stress from their lives as possible.Stress can cause problems for both the fetus as well as the woman carrying it.In extreme cases, extreme amounts of stress can cause the baby to be born too soon.

Your obstetrician will likely recommend a prenatal vitamin at your first visit. You should take these every day. Each supplement will be full of vitamins that you might not be getting. They are specially designed to allow your body to give the baby everything it needs to develop healthily.

If you are experiencing constipation during your pregnancy, increase your consumption of high fiber foods such as vegetables, fruits and whole grain breads and cereals. Constipation in pregnancy is caused during pregnancy by hormones. This can lead to severe problems and it is very uncomfortable to deal with.
